    Llancaiach Fawr celebrates two prestigious awards from Visit Wales

    Rhys GregoryBy Rhys GregoryApril 3, 2023No Comments
    Share Facebook Twitter Copy Link LinkedIn Email WhatsApp
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link

    Llancaiach Fawr are celebrating two prestigious awards from Visit Wales.

    The historic visitor attraction in Caerphilly recently won both the Visit Wales ‘Best Told Story 2023 / 24’ and the new category ‘Quality Food and Drink 2023 / 24  accolades, awarded by VAQAS,(the Visitor Attraction Quality Assurance Service), following a mystery shopper visit by representatives of the tourism industry regulatory body.

    The site was praised for its well organised gift shop, excellent café / restaurant menu, using locally sourced ingredients and the outstanding knowledge of the Historical Interpreters who guide visitors around the manor dressed and in character as the servants of Colonel Pritchard who like nothing better than to cease their duties and gossip about the master and mistress, bringing history to life!

    Deputy Minister for Arts and Sports, Dawn Bowden, said: “I’d like to congratulate the team at Llancaich Fawr for their hard work in achieving this recognition from Visit Wales – and providing visitors with a first-class experience which also brings our history and culture to life.  I hope that people will take time over the Easter Holidays to experience Llanciach Fawr.”

    Lesley Edwards, General Manager commented, “We are so pleased to be recognised for the unique customer experience we provide”.

    Cllr Jamie Pritchard, the Council’s Deputy Leader and Cabinet Member with responsibility for Tourism added, “I am delighted that our much loved visitor attraction, Llancaiach Fawr Manor, has received the recognition it deserves”.
